Disclose Notes: Collects Marvel Knights: Hulk (Marvel, 2013 series) #1-4 and The Incredible Hulk (Marvel, 1962 series) #1.

Half-man, half-monster, the mighty Hulk thunders out of the night to take his place among the most amazing characters of all time!
Scientist Bruce Banner saves a young boy from being killed by a nuclear blast but absorbs deadly amounts of gamma radiation which transforms him into a monster dubbed the Hulk. Bruce Banner is scientist by day, but transforms into the Hulk once the sun goes down.

Holy Hannah!
The Gargoyle captures the Hulk and Rick Jones and transports them behind the Iron Curtain. The Hulk transforms back into Banner who offers to help cure the Gargoyle of his affliction. The Gargoyle, who wants nothing more than to be a normal man, agrees to be cured; once cured, the Gargoyle helps Banner and Jones escape back to America.
